I60.4 is the ICD-10 code for Subarachnoid haemorrhage from basilar artery. It is a four-character subcategory of I60 (Subarachnoid haemorrhage), the most specific level in the WHO edition. It belongs to the block I60–I69 (Cerebrovascular diseases) in Chapter IX, Diseases of the circulatory system.
